Mercy Heart Foundation Donates to Nsawam Female Prison

The Mercy Heart Foundation, a Non-Governmental Organization and a member of the Caroline Group of companies has donated various assorted items to the Nsawam Female Prison.
The items, worth thousands of Ghana cedis included 1,000piece of sanitary pads, packs of Bel Aqua mineral water, washing powder, bathing soaps, toiletries, amongst others.
The donation which took place on Saturday, July 25, 2020, is in fulfilment of the promise of the CEO of the Caroline Group, Miss Caroline Esinam Adzogble to support inmates of the prison with Sanitary pads and other items.
According to the Mercy Heart Foundation, the donation is part of its ‘Freedom of Women From Prisons’ project which is aimed at donating various items to all female prisons across the country annually. The project will also include paying fines of women who are in prison due to their inability to pay their fines
Women in some prisons in the country sometimes resort to the use of clothing and tissue paper during their monthly due to their inability to buy sanitary pads.

In addressing the issue, the Mercy Heart Foundation Ceo indicated that as part of the ‘Freedom of Women Prisons project, sanitary pad banks will be installed throughout the country “which is an interesting initiative to free women from using clothes, tissues etc. for their monthly periods as well as ensure some innocent once get freed.”
Speaking to the media during the donation, Miss Caroline Esinam said she was hopeful the initiative would touch the lives of the inmates.
“In this regard, we hope to touch lives by ensuring the women we pay fines for are innocent and have stories that can inspire others out there. Miss Caroline indicated that she and her team are working closely with officials on cases that deserve bail payouts. The project will be an annual event across all prisons in Ghana every year by stocking the pad bank with 1000 piece of sanitary pads, water, beauty kits etc. to enable our mothers and sisters in prisons have a comfortable life whiles they serve their term.”

The CEO also encouraged the inmates to keep being strong and not to give up.

IHRO Of UN Cautions Self Acclaimed Counselor
International Human Rights Observer (IHRO) has cautioned self acclaimed counselor George Lutterodt promoting rape on National Television.
The unfortunate comments made by George lutterodt has received wide condemnation from Ministry for Gender, Children and social protection as well as other personalities.

From the excerpts of the broadcast on Adom TV, a local media network, the self acclaimed counselor said rape victims enjoy the act of being raped.
However IHRO in their press release has called on the African Court on Human and people’s Right – Hague to take actions against counselor lutterodt.
Based on the various concerns received and with his recent unfortunate utterances, the UN IHRO is backing the Ministry of Gender in its calls to bring him to order.
In a statement signed by the Dr. Steven Ackah Executive Secretary to the Country director, IHRO has cautioned George Lutterodt to retract his unfortunate comments and apologize to the general public.
It has given an ultimatum to self acclaimed counselor George Lutterodt retract his comments and apologize to the general public or face their wrath.
The International Human Rights Observer is however joining hands with the Ministry to ask that he be prevented from appearing in both International and Local media houses. The IHRO further calls on the African Court on Human and Peoples’ Rights-Hague to take actions against him. And to call on the Ghana Media Commission, Ghana Psychology Council and other stakeholders to take actions against him and to retrieve the said video from all digital platforms.
